How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 27606?

27606 apartments
Bed Type Average Rent Range
Studio $950 $950 - $1,450
1BR $1,260 $650 - $1,550
2BR $1,510 $1,200 - $1,900
3BR $1,830 $1,270 - $2,720
4+BR $3,200 $2,400 - $4,000

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million Rentable list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
